Output 678304fbb655504307d1d5a8e0341984264fc0185ca85dc6e39f9dacd0b5c99d:1

value
1526592
script pubkey
OP_0 OP_PUSHBYTES_20 303fb346148dbb7f07b9fbae7a90b65ec80d593d
address
ltc1qxqlmx3s53kah7paelwh84y9ktmyq6kface8039
transaction
678304fbb655504307d1d5a8e0341984264fc0185ca85dc6e39f9dacd0b5c99d
spent
true